titleOfInvention | A kind of aluminum alloy materials and its low-pressure casting method substituting QT500 agricultural machinery hydraulic pumps |
abstract | The present invention discloses a kind of aluminum alloy materials substituting QT500 agricultural machinery hydraulic pumps, it is characterised in that:Principal component content is by weight percentage:Strontium Sr:0.02%~0.03%, manganese Mn:≤ 2%, cadmium Cd:0.05%~0.5%, copper Cu:4.2%~8.0% and Cu >=0.8Mn+4.05%;Lewis Acids and Bases are to total amount 1% × 10 ‑4 ~2.0%, surplus is aluminium Al. |
